Haniff Hoosen made the trip from Durban to BizNews's Hermanus studio with a blunt message: the ANC is finished in eThekwini, and what replaces it could be worse. The DA's mayoral candidate walked through how a metro that once out-drew Cape Town for tourists now loses 65% of its water to 13,000 active leaks, why he believes MK is running a placeholder candidate to make way for a scandal-tainted former mayor, and why he isn't arguing with The Economist's description of South Africa drifting into a "mafia state." He also put a number on his own chances in November: five out of ten, a coin flip between the DA and a party he says is already broke.
